The Dirty Truth About Maximum Bet Limits

This is where 90% of players get burned. You sign up for a “high roller” bonus. It says “100% up to $1,000.” You deposit $1,000. You think you can play $100 spins. Wrong. Read the terms: “Maximum bet with an active bonus is $5 per spin.”

So you’re stuck playing penny pokies while trying to wager $35,000. That’s a joke. From what I’ve seen, the best real money casinos in Australia for 2026 that actually allow high bets during bonus play are Betway and Bet365. Bet365 has a $10 max bet rule, but it’s per spin, not per round. Betway allows $15 per spin. Still low, but better than $5.

If you want to play without bonus restrictions, you need to play in “real money mode” without claiming the bonus. That’s the only way to get the high-stakes tables you want. Casinos hate it when you do this, because they make less money, but it’s the only way to play big.

Is it legal to play online casinos for real money in Australia in 2026?

Yes and no. The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 makes it illegal for operators to offer “real money” online casino games to Aussie players if they are based in Australia. But offshore casinos (like the ones I listed) are not subject to that law. So it’s legal for you to play, but it’s a gray area for the operator. You won’t get arrested for playing at Betway. That’s the short version.

What is the best withdrawal method for Aussie players?

From what I’ve seen, POLi is the most common. It’s an Australian bank transfer system. Most casinos support it. Processing times are 1-3 days. The alternative is Skrill or Neteller, but some casinos exclude e-wallet deposits from bonus eligibility. Always check the terms. Bank transfers are slow (5-7 days) but reliable.

The One Thing You Should Never Do

Don’t chase losses. I know it’s cliché, but I see it every day. You lose $500 on a pokie. You deposit another $500 to “win it back.” You lose that too. Now you’re down $1,000. The casino knows this. They design the games to encourage this behavior. The maximum bet limits are there to protect you, but also to keep you playing longer.

Set a budget. $200 per session. If you lose it, walk away. If you win, withdraw 50% immediately. That’s the only way to come out ahead in the long run. The house always has the edge. Your job is to minimize that edge and cash out when you’re up.
